Ldap injection in c# example
WebIn this type of attack, an attacker can spoof identity; expose, tamper, destroy, or make existing data unavailable; become the Administrator of the database server. SSI Injection. Allows an attacker to send code to a web application, which will later be executed locally by the web server. In this type of attack, an attacker exploits the failure ... WebIn this recipe, we will identify the LDAP injection vulnerability in code and fix the security vulnerability. Getting ready. Using Visual Studio Code, open the sample Online Banking app folder at \Chapter02\ldap-injection\before\OnlineBankingApp\. How to do it… Let's take a look at the steps for this recipe:
Ldap injection in c# example
Did you know?
Web2 jun. 2024 · LDAP Injection Examples Using Logical Operators An LDAP filter can be used to make a query that’s missing a logic operator ( OR and AND ). An injection like: … Web22 jun. 2024 · Add the following in the ConfigureServices method of your Startup.cs: services.AddScoped (); This allows us to get the appropriate service when we inject IAuthenticationService in our controller class. For example, in our SecurityController: [Route("api/ [controller]/ [action]")] public class ...
WebBack to: Design Patterns in C# With Real-Time Examples Inversion of Control (IoC) in C#. In this article, I am going to discuss the Inversion of Control in C#.The Inversion of Control is also called IoC in C#. As a … WebLdapDirectoryIdentifier identifier = new LdapDirectoryIdentifier (TargetServer, 636); // Configure network credentials (userid and password) var secureString = new SecureString (); foreach (var character in password) secureString.AppendChar (character); NetworkCredential creds = new NetworkCredential (LDAPUser, secureString); // Actually …
Web19 dec. 2024 · JSON Injection Prevention. As with most injection vulnerabilities, the key to maintaining web application security and preventing JSON injections is to sanitize data. This applies to both server-side and client-side JSON injections. To prevent server-side JSON injections, sanitize all data before serializing it to JSON. Web29 sep. 2024 · LDAP是一個提供Access Control和分散式資訊維護的目錄資訊。 LDAP Injection與SQL Injection和ORM Injection有點相似,不一樣的是,LDAP是利用用戶參數來產生的LDAP查詢。 跟常見的測試方法相似,利用輸入一些會讓LDAP混淆的無意義字元,若LDAP Server return錯誤訊息,就可能代表這可能具有漏洞。 例如原本的User為 Craig , …
WebIf one uses property injection how do you set properties on that type? For example We can use DI to resolve ITimer but how/where do we define property values for ITimer, for example, if you want to set the ... c# / asp.net-mvc-3 / dependency-injection / inversion-of-control / structuremap. Resolve 2 properties of the same type in Autofac ...
WebLDAP injection is, at heart, quite similar to SQL injection. LDAP is a look-up protocol for information stored about an organization. It also has an authentication system, as much of this information can be confidential or private. However, if not implemented correctly, LDAP authentication can be circumvented and/or cause some nasty information ... sword of kusanagi orochimaruWeb16 mrt. 2024 · Example 1. In this example, we’ll see how by using LDAP Injection, we can bypass the authentication mechanism. Let’s take a few moments first to understand the syntax of the LDAP query. From the database we retrieve the user records by its CN (Common Name) attribute, which is one of the required attributes of the “person” class. sword of legend online frWeb27 feb. 2024 · In C#, Dependency Injection is a technique used to achieve loose coupling between classes and their dependencies. It is a design pattern that allows for the separation of concerns in an application, making it more maintainable, testable, and flexible. In Dependency Injection, dependencies are injected into a class from the outside rather … sword of laban replicaWeb19 jul. 2012 · DirectoryEntry ("LDAP://myserver/OU=People,O=mycompany", username, password); should be for an account that has permission for directory lookup. It could be … sword of legends online mountsWhen working with untrusted input, be mindful of Lightweight Directory Access Protocol (LDAP) injection attacks. An attacker can potentially run malicious LDAP statements against information directories. Applications that use user input to construct dynamic LDAP statements to access directory … Meer weergeven Potentially untrusted HTTP request input reaches an LDAP statement. By default, this rule analyzes the entire codebase, but this is … Meer weergeven If you just want to suppress a single violation, add preprocessor directives to your source file to disable and then re-enable the rule. To disable the rule for a file, folder, or … Meer weergeven For the user-controlled portion of LDAP statements, consider one o: 1. Allow only a safe list of non-special characters. 2. Disallow … Meer weergeven Use the following options to configure which parts of your codebase to run this rule on. 1. Exclude specific symbols 2. Exclude specific types and their derived types You can … Meer weergeven sword of legends online gameplayWeb20 dec. 2016 · LDAP injection in LDAP query c#. this is my bool connection for validating whether an user is in AD group or not. I got a security flag in my code. private bool … sword of lifesteal 5eWeb28 apr. 2024 · Here are 27 common vulnerabilities that affect C# applications. ... In an SQL injection attack, for example, ... Using LDAP injection, ... text adventure games cell phone